Minamishinkyoji Temple

Minamishinkyoji Temple

📍 Kyoto

Minami Shinkyoji, in the Daigokuden area of Kaide, is a Nichiren temple and the centre of a community that converted wholesale at the end of the Kamakura period, when the priest Nichizo preached here and every villager took up the Nichiren teaching. Minami Shinkyoji and Kita Shinkyoji were originally a single temple standing on the site of the present Kita Shinkyoji; this half was moved here when a seminary was opened. The main hall and founder's hall, built in the early Edo period, are designated cultural properties of Kyoto Prefecture.
